Today Ophelia was upgraded to cat 3/5 and is approaching the Azores, it should reach Ireland on Monday, very weakened and most probable downgraded to a storm.

But with winds up to 120km/h it will still be serious business.

Ophelia already claimed 3 souls.

Though it is now a post tropical storm, its winds of 130km/h forced the Irish government to close the schools for Monday and Tuesday.
